Driveway Solutions for Sandy Coastal Soils

Deal's geology consists primarily of sandy soils typical of barrier island formations along the New Jersey coast. These well-drained soils present specific challenges for driveway construction. The Downer-Lakewood soil association common in Monmouth County requires proper base preparation to prevent settling and rutting.

The key to successful driveway construction in Deal lies in proper base preparation using compactable aggregates. Our crusher run creates an excellent foundation that locks together under compaction, providing stability even in sandy conditions. This base layer prevents the driveway surface from sinking into the native soil, a common problem with coastal properties.

For the surface layer, three-quarter inch crushed stone offers excellent drainage and a stable driving surface. The angular nature of crushed stone allows particles to interlock, creating a firm surface that resists displacement. Many Deal homeowners prefer the clean appearance and superior performance of quality crushed aggregates over less stable alternatives.

Drainage Management for Coastal Properties

Effective drainage is critical for properties near the ocean. Deal's proximity to the Atlantic Ocean and Deal Lake means many properties have high water tables that require management. French drains using number 57 stone effectively channel water away from foundations and prevent basement moisture problems common in coastal areas.

The sandy soils that characterize Deal actually provide natural drainage advantages when properly managed. However, compacted areas around foundations and driveways need supplemental drainage systems. Drain rock placed in trenches or along foundation walls allows water to percolate quickly, preventing hydrostatic pressure that can damage structures.

Properties near Deal Lake often experience seasonal water table fluctuations. Installing proper drainage systems with quality aggregates protects landscaping investments and prevents water accumulation that damages lawns and gardens. Road base combined with proper grading ensures water flows away from structures toward appropriate drainage points.

Deal's Climate and Soil Considerations

Understanding local environmental conditions helps property owners select aggregates that perform optimally in Deal's unique coastal setting. The borough experiences a humid subtropical climate with average temperatures ranging from 32°F in winter to 85°F in summer, though ocean breezes moderate extremes.

Annual precipitation averages 47 inches, distributed fairly evenly throughout the year. However, coastal storms and nor'easters can bring intense rainfall that tests drainage systems. The sandy, well-drained soils common throughout Deal handle water quickly, but proper aggregate selection ensures long-term stability and prevents erosion.

The frost line in Monmouth County sits at approximately 30 inches depth. While freeze-thaw cycles are less severe than inland areas, they still impact aggregate performance. Crushed stone materials that compact well resist frost heave better than loose, round aggregates. This characteristic makes crusher run and road base particularly suitable for Deal driveways that need to withstand winter conditions.

Salt air from the Atlantic Ocean influences material selection for properties near the oceanfront. While aggregates themselves resist salt damage, they play a crucial role in drainage systems that protect metal and concrete components from salt intrusion. Proper drainage using quality stone materials extends the life of all hardscape elements.

The sandy Downer series soils characteristic of Deal offer excellent natural drainage but limited structural support without proper base preparation. These soils formed from marine deposits and consist primarily of quartz sand. Adding compactable aggregate bases creates the solid foundation necessary for driveways and other hardscape features in this sandy substrate.

Professional Installation Guidance for Coastal Properties

Successful aggregate installation in Deal requires understanding coastal soil conditions and proper construction techniques. Always begin driveway projects by removing organic topsoil down to stable sandy subsoil. This step prevents future settling and ensures a solid foundation.

For driveways on Deal's sandy soils, install a compacted crusher run base at least 4 to 6 inches deep. This base layer provides the structural foundation that sandy soils cannot supply naturally. Compact the base in lifts using a plate compactor or roller for maximum density and stability.

Top the base with 2 to 3 inches of three-quarter inch crushed stone, again compacting thoroughly. The surface layer provides the driving surface while allowing water to drain through to the base layer. Proper compaction at each stage prevents future rutting and extends driveway life.

French drain installation requires excavating trenches to below the frost line, approximately 30 to 36 inches in Deal. Line trenches with landscape fabric to prevent sand infiltration, then fill with number 57 stone around perforated drain pipe. This system effectively manages the high water tables common near Deal Lake and along the coast.

When creating decorative stone areas using pea gravel or river rock, install landscape fabric beneath the stone to prevent it from working into sandy soil. Edge restraints keep decorative stone contained and maintain clean borders. These simple steps ensure long-lasting aesthetic appeal for Deal's beautiful properties.

How do I calculate aggregate quantities for my Deal property?

Calculate area in square feet (length times width), then multiply by depth in feet. For a driveway 20 feet wide and 50 feet long with 4 inch depth: 20 x 50 x 0.33 equals 330 cubic feet, or about 12 cubic yards. What makes aggregates better than asphalt for Deal driveways?

Aggregate driveways offer superior drainage, lower initial cost, easier repairs, and excellent performance in sandy coastal soils. They do not soften in summer heat like asphalt can, and adding fresh stone periodically maintains appearance and function.
